To clarify, are you talking about the Aux input to hook up your iPod or the full iPod integration kit? The Aux input is only about $150-$200 installed but the full integration kit is around ~$600. The part itself for the integration kit is already $300 but you can buy it from Garry Romani of Newport BMW, NJ for 25% off. See the sticky thread at the top of the Parts & Accessories Forum for his contact info. Labor is about another $300 or so.
